A real head turner...
One for those who wanted a head turn after the last frame! I posted the other one as I preferred the wing position and the light, so it'll be interesting to see if the stare towards the camera can over-ride the deficiencies.
I was actually on the phone to a friend as this one gave us a pass, telling him he needed to be a few hundred yards further up the track, so I was fortunate the focus held as I missed with the AF point. As such I had to add a little extra canvas to the top of the frame. To add to things as I picked the camera up I must have rolled the front dial so the shot was 1 stop underexposed - recovered in PP
Canon 1dx
500mm f4 is + 1.4x
ISO 1000
1/8000th (!) at f6.3
